13. Advice of receipt of goods<br />

Finally, the consignee can confirm to the consignor the reception of the goods.<br />

If EDI is used, this is confirmed by the RECADV message.<br />

14. Return of empty container(s)<br />

Once the consignee has unloaded the goods he will release the containers by announcing<br />

them to the carrier. This date/time may influence the charges linked to the usage of the<br />

container(s).<br />

In a general way the wagons are sent back to the equipment owner or lessee.<br />

Practically we can consider two different cases:<br />

a. The empty containers are kept by the customer in order to be re-used <strong>for</strong> a new<br />

consignment.<br />

There is no additional message needed since this will be included in the scenario of<br />

the new transport loop, where these containers will be part of (re: commercial<br />

contract <strong>for</strong> practical procedure).<br />

b. The empty containers are sent back to the container owner.<br />

If EDI is used, this will be done by the message COPARN.
